The LM3674MFX-1.2 is a high-efficiency, step-down DC/DC converter designed and manufactured by Texas Instruments. This compact and versatile power management integrated circuit (IC) is specifically engineered to meet the needs of low-voltage, battery-powered applications, including portable devices and wearables.
Key Features
- Adjustable Output Voltage: The device provides a fixed output voltage of 1.2V, which is ideal for powering advanced digital circuits that require stable and efficient low-voltage supply.
- High Efficiency: With an efficiency of up to 95%, the LM3674MFX-1.2 ensures minimal power loss during conversion, extending battery life in portable applications.
- Load Capability: It can deliver up to 600mA of continuous load current, catering to a wide range of power requirements.
- Low Quiescent Current: The quiescent current is as low as 15µA, which is beneficial for battery conservation in standby and idle modes.
- Fast Transient Response: The device's excellent transient response allows it to maintain output voltage stability in the face of rapid load changes, which is crucial for high-performance digital electronics.
- Small Footprint: Housed in a tiny 5-pin SOT-23 package, the LM3674MFX-1.2 saves valuable board space, making it suitable for compact PCB layouts.
Applications
The LM3674MFX-1.2 is an ideal choice for powering a variety of applications, including:
- Mobile phones and PDAs
- Wireless LAN and Bluetooth devices
- Digital cameras and audio players
- Portable medical equipment
- Other battery-operated devices
